
From Wikipedia
Mário Rodrigues Breves Peixoto (Brussels, Belgium March 3, 1908 – Rio de Janeiro, Brazil February 3, 1992) was a Brazilian film director, mainly known for his only film Limite, a silent experimental film filmed in 1930 and premiered in Rio de Janeiro on 17 May 1931. Peixoto wrote, directed and took up a minor role in the film.
